MicroController Pros Home Page My Account  Cart Contents  Checkout  
  Store » Microchip PIC » Programmers » ICP2-2/1 My Account  |  Cart Contents  |  Checkout   
Quick Find
Enter keywords to find the product you are looking for in the Quick Find field above

or use
Advanced Search
Accessory Boards->
ADI Blackfin
Atmel AVR->
Cypress PSoC
Microchip PIC->
  In-Circuit Debuggers
    ICSP Adapters
  Starter & Evaluation Kits
Silicon Labs
ST Microelectronics->
Texas Instruments->
Embedded Ethernet->
Embedded Software->
I/O Modules->
Parts & Components->
Pick & Place Tools
Programmable Logic (PLD)
Prototype PCBs->
ROM/Flash Emulators
Test & Measurement->
Tutorial Software
Universal Programmers->
Intro to Embedded Tools
Embedded News Digest
Useful Resources
Shipping & Returns
Warranty & Liability
Privacy Notice
Conditions of Use
Contact Us
ICSP Production Programmer for PIC, Keeloq & EEPROMs US$399.00

ICSP Production Programmer for PIC, Keeloq & EEPROMs

  • Production quality
  • Full down compatibility with ICP-01
  • Ultra-fast programming
  • Cost-effective
  • Windows® DLL/Command Line functions
  • Adaptable to bed-of-nails systems
  • On-board flash memory 1Mbyte per channel
  • The ICP2 Production Quality In-Circuit Programmer is a cost-effective programmer for mid-volume production, service and development. The ICP2 features overcurrent protection circuits, which prevent both programmed devices and the programmer from being damaged. Windows® DLL/Command Line functions are suitable for high-volume automatic programming. Once all necessary parameters are set up, you can quickly and securely duplicate devices in production one-touch programming mode. Built-in bootloader allows convenient field firmware upgrade via software. Complete package comes with ICP2 programmer unit, power adapter, USB cable and Sub-D mating connector.

    Compatible Operating Systems:

    Windows® 95/98/2000/ME/XP/NT/Vista/7

    PIC In-Circuit Programmer Features

    • Especially designed for in-circuit programming (ICSP) of Microchip® 8-bit PIC® MCUs,16-bit PIC® MCUs & dsPIC® DSCs (optional), Keeloq® encoders (optional) and serial EEPROMs (24Cxx Series) — View Supported Device List
    • Ultra fast operation, up to 64 channels simultaneously — see ICP Family Programming Times
    • Full down compatibility with ICP-01
    • Communication interface: USB, RS-232 and Bluetooth (optional)
    • On-board flash memory 1MByte for non-volatile storage of HEX, configuration and serialization files
    • Remote programming via 3 lines: Enter/Pass/Fail
    • Programmable Vdd (2.0 to 5.5V) and Vpp (2.0 to 13.5V)
    • Programmable delay between Vdd and Vpp (0.1 to 250ms)
    • Programmable clock/data speed (500KHz to 2.5MHz)
    • Programmable Vdd source (ICP2 or target)
    • Vdd current limit: 250mA (40mA if powered from USB only)
    • Tests Vdd and Vpp for overload with indication by software
    • No damage to connected microcontroller in case of power ON and power OFF
    • Optional socket modules (DIP, SOIC, SSOP, etc.)
    • Optional clips for in-circuit programming
    • 4 serialization schemes: sequential, random, pseudo-random and user file, 1 to 8 bytes, automatic "retlw"
    • Secure programming feature including hex file encryption, counter and secure buffer (optional)
    • Built-in low-voltage programming (LVP)
    • Adaptable to bed-of-nails systems
    • Windows® DLL/Command Line functions for automatic programming (optional)
    • Field firmware upgrade (built-in bootloader)


    LxWxH: 175 x 85 x 35mm


    1.2 kg

    ATE Compatible

    Final test machine (FTM) functions in DLL allow the ICP2 software to integrate easily with test equipment, working in either standalone mode or driven by a host system. Adaptable to bed-of-nails and other types of ATEs, ICP2 helps you preserve your investment in test equipment.

    Secure Programming Option

    Utilizing patent-pending technology, this optional software feature provides several layers of protection that dramatically reduce the risk of unauthorized reconstruction of hex files. These include strong hex file encryption, a counter that ensures the number of programmed devices does not exceed a pre-defined value, and a secure buffer of "invisible" hex data stored in ICP2 protected memory.


    Software Add-On Options

    The unit you order form this page comes with programming support for 8-bit PIC MCUs, some 16-bit devices, rfPIC, and 24Cxx EEPROMs. Optional software add-ons are available, which you can select below.

    • The DLL Option adds Command-line support and Windows DLL support for automatic programming from your own application code.
    • The dsPIC Option adds programming support for Microchip dsPIC and PIC24 devices
    • the PIC32 Option adds programming support for Microchip PIC32 devices
    • The Keeloq Option adds programming support for Microchip HCS300/301/320 and HCS360/361/362 Keeloq devices
    • The Secure Option adds software and firmware for hex file encryption, counter and secure buffer support

    Note: Using the checkboxes below gives you a discount over purchasing the add-ons at a later date. If you want to get the DLL and one or two of the device support add-ons, use the Bundle selector above the checkboxes instead, for an even more reduced price. If you select one of the bundle options, you should not select the same options with the checkboxes. For example, if you want the DLL and all three device support add-ons, you can get the lowest price by choosing the DLL+dsPIC+Keeloq bundle and selecting the PIC32 checkbox.

    Lead time: 1 week

    Available Options:

    Optional Recommended Products for this Item
    Windows & Command Line DLL Support for ICP2 PIC Programmer+ US$150.00
    dsPIC and PIC24 Programming Support for ICP2 PIC Programmer+ US$150.00
    PIC32 Programming Support for ICP2 PIC Programmer+ US$150.00
    Keeloq Device Programming Support for ICP2 PIC programmer+ US$150.00
    Secure Programming Support for ICP2 PIC Programmer+ US$499.00
    1000V DC USB Isolator+ US$42.45

    This product was added to our catalog on Thursday 23 October, 2008.


    Customers who bought this product also purchased
    1000V DC USB Isolator1000V DC USB IsolatorUS$42.45

    Shopping Cart more
    0 items
    What's New? more
    Flowcode 7 "Test & Debugging" Feature Pack
    Flowcode 7 "Test & Debugging" Feature Pack
    Specials more
    XBee ZigBee Module, 50mW, Series 2.5, RPSMA Antenna Connector
    XBee ZigBee Module, 50mW, Series 2.5, RPSMA Antenna Connector
    Tell A Friend

    Tell someone you know about this product.
    Notifications more
    NotificationsNotify me of updates to ICSP Production Programmer for PIC, Keeloq & EEPROMs
    Reviews more
    Write ReviewWrite a review on this product!
      Friday 03 July, 2020   List of all our Products

    Copyright © 2003-2017 MicroController Pros LLC
    Powered by osCommerce